The Mechanics of Earning Comp Points
The fundamental principle behind earning comp points is simple: the more you play, the more points you accrue. Most casinos operate on a straightforward conversion rate, for example, earning 1 comp point for every £10 wagered. However, the devil is often in the details. Different game types typically contribute at different rates. Slots, being the most popular casino game, often offer the highest rate of point accumulation, making them a favourite for players looking to boost their comp balance quickly.
Table games, while often offering a lower point-earning rate, can still be a viable option, especially for players who prefer strategic gameplay. For instance, you might earn 1 comp point for every £20 wagered on blackjack or roulette. Video poker and other specialty games usually fall somewhere in between. It’s always wise to check the casino’s specific terms and conditions to understand the exact earning rates for each game you enjoy playing.

Understanding Wagering Requirements on Redeemed Bonuses
This is a critical point for any experienced gambler to grasp. While redeeming comp points for bonus cash is fantastic, it’s rarely a case of simply taking free money. Most online casinos will attach wagering requirements to any bonus funds received through comp point redemption. This means you’ll need to wager the bonus amount a certain number of times before you can withdraw any winnings derived from it.
For example, if you redeem 1000 comp points for £10 in bonus cash, and the wagering requirement is 35x, you’ll need to wager £350 (£10 x 35) before you can cash out any winnings. It’s essential to be aware of these requirements, as they can significantly impact the actual value of your redeemed points. Always check the terms and conditions associated with bonus redemptions.
Here’s a quick checklist to keep in mind when redeeming comp points for bonuses:
- Check the Wagering Requirement: Is it reasonable?
- Understand Game Contributions: Not all games contribute equally to fulfilling wagering requirements. Slots usually contribute 100%, while table games might contribute less.
- Note the Expiry Date: Bonuses often have a time limit to be used and wagered.
- Look for Maximum Cashout Limits: Some bonuses have a cap on how much you can win and withdraw.
